28 selected for best teacher awards

ISLAMABAD, Nov 22: The Higher Education Commission (HEC) on Monday announced "Best University Teachers Awards" for 2003-04 under which 28 teachers representing various public-sector universities and degree-awarding institutions of the country have been selected for the honour.

An official statement issued here on Monday said these award winners would be given certificates and a cash prize of Rs100,000 each. The names of the award winners are:
